<データ> TABEL
キー 値
1 10
2 20
3 30
上記のデータでSQL取得結で
キー 値 累計
1 10 10
2 20 30
3 30 60
累計を伴ったデータを取得したいのでが
DECLARE を使った変数ではうまくゆきません
DECLARE @累計 = 0
SELECT キー, 値,
(@累計 = @累計 + 値) AS 累計 --代入と取得の混合はエラー!
ご存じの方がいらしたらご教授願います
RDBの種類とバージョンはなんでしょう?
これってプロシージャでやらないとダメなのですか?
回答1件
あなたの回答
tips
プレビュー